A general officer, or general, is an officer of high rank in an army. com Jul 7, 2012 · Romanian Army - Order of Battle - 1989 - Terse In 1989 the ground forces numbered 140,000 men, of whom two-thirds were conscripted soldiers. The army had eight motor rifle divisions, two tank divisions, six mountain brigades, two artillery brigades, a rocket brigade with a few “Scud” ballistic missiles, and four airborne regiments.
